支气管动脉栓塞与血栓塞的保守治疗相比:系统性审查和元分析

概括
支气管动脉栓塞 (BAE) 比保守治疗血栓塞更有效,减少复发和死亡率. BAE具有很高的临床成功率,并没有很大的并发症,这使其成为首选的干预选择.

背景情况:
- 支气管动脉栓塞 (BAE) 是血栓塞的关键治疗方法.
- 缺乏关于BAE有效性和安全性的共识,阻碍了其在血液流管理中的广泛采用.
研究的目的:
- 评估BAE的临床益处,与血栓塞的保守治疗相比.
- 综合关于复发率,临床成功,死亡率和并发症的证据.
主要方法:
- 在PubMed,Embase,ScienceDirect,CochraneLibrary和ClinicalTrials的系统文献搜索到2023年3月.
- 包括随机对照试验 (RCT) 和队列研究,比较BAE与血栓塞的保守治疗.
- 使用几率比率 (OR) 和95%置信区间 (CI) 的聚合数据的元分析.
主要成果:
- 分析了12项涉及1231名患者的研究 (3项RCT,9个队列).
- 与保守治疗相比,BAE显示出更低的血复发率 (26.5%vs34.6%) 和更高的临床成功率 (92.2%vs80.9%).
- BAE显著降低了与血液溶解相关的死亡率 (0.8%与3.2%) 与较低的重大并发症发病率 (0.2%).
结论:
- 在控制血和减少复发方面,BAE优于保守治疗.
- BAE显著降低了与血结相关的死亡率,严重并发症的风险可以忽略不计.
- 这些发现支持BAE作为血液的有效治疗选择.
